The Socialists have come out victorious in early parliamentary elections held in Greece on Sunday. George Papandreou's Panhellenic Socialist Movement (Pasok) was the strongest force with 44 percent of the vote, ousting Kostas Karamanlis' conservative Nea Dimokratia party. The European press comments on the election results and the expectations Papandreou must now live up to.
